What does rat poison smell like? - in detail

The odor emitted by rodent control products varies with the active ingredient and formulation. Anticoagulant baits, such as those containing warfarin, brodifacoum, or difenacoum, typically have a faint, slightly sweet or metallic scent that is barely perceptible to humans but can be detected by rodents’ sensitive olfactory system. Second‑generation anticoagulants often include flavoring agents—peanut, chocolate, or grain extracts—that mask the chemical smell and make the bait more attractive.

Bromadiolone‑based formulations frequently incorporate a strong, oily aroma reminiscent of petroleum or mineral oil, resulting from the compound’s solvent base. Zinc phosphide, a phosphide poison, reacts with moisture to release phosphine gas, which has a characteristic garlic‑like or decaying fish odor. This smell is sharp and can be recognized by trained personnel, but it dissipates quickly in open air.

Metal phosphide powders, such as aluminum phosphide, generate phosphine with a pungent, acrid odor similar to that of rotten eggs or sulfur. The detection threshold for humans lies around 0.5 ppm, making the smell noticeable in confined spaces.

Aromatic attractants added to bait—cereal, fruit, or meat extracts—can dominate the overall scent profile, concealing the underlying chemical odor. Consequently, the perceived smell depends on the balance between active toxicant and added flavorings.

Key points for identification:

  • Anticoagulants: faint sweet/metallic note; often flavored.
  • Bromadiolone: oily, petroleum‑like smell.
  • Zinc phosphide: garlic or decaying fish odor, short‑lived.
  • Aluminum phosphide: strong rotten‑egg or sulfur scent, detectable at low concentrations.
  • Flavor additives: can mask or override the toxicant’s aroma.

Safety protocols advise handling all rodent poisons in well‑ventilated areas and using protective equipment, as some odors indicate the presence of hazardous gases that may pose health risks. Detection devices, such as phosphine monitors, are recommended for environments where phosphide products are used.
